After the Warriors fell 115-110 to the Los Angeles Clippers on Sunday, the two teams will face off again in the NBA play-in tournament. "Dubs Talk" co-hosts Bonta Hill and Monte Poole break down what Golden State needs to do differently in Wednesday night’s play-in game in order to see a different outcome.
